Studies in Poverty and Inequality InstituteThis project set out to develop a tool with which to monitor and evaluate the progressive realisation of socio-economic rights in South Africa. The aim is twofold: firstly, to move towards an agreement on what progressive realisation of socio-economic rights means in South Africa – to what end and over what time span – and secondly, to develop a method of monitoring and evaluating progress made to date and in the future.

Republic of South AfricaThe Studies in Poverty and Inequality Institute (SPII) decided to launch its Basic Needs Basket research programme. The Basic Needs Basket is a monthly survey of the cost of essential food and non- food items that comprise the minimum basket of goods needed for an averaged sized family to survive with a decent and healthy standard of living.
